G8000MM UPS Main Features
State-of-the-Art Modular Design Provides Maximum Flexibility
The Toshiba G8000MM Uninterruptible Power System utilizes state-of-the-art design and construction to deliver industry-leading reliability and the flexibility to meet today’s critical power demands.
• Technologically Advanced Control of Fast-Switching IGBTs Delivers
94% Efficiency
• Combination Diode Bridge and Broad Range Harmonic Input Filter
Delivers Low Input Total Harmonic Distortion (THD)
• Low THD Reduces Heat Loss in Associated Feed Equipment and
Increases Component Life
• Self-Contained Modular Design Allows Low Cost Future Expansion
• Combine up to Eight Modules for Increased Capacity or
Redundancy
• Highly Efficient Hybrid Static-Transfer Switch Built Into Each Module
• Parallel Output Tie-Cabinet Requires Minimal Intelligence Circuitry
Reducing Purchase Cost
• Superior Output Voltage Regulation Provides Non-Distorted Output

• Generator-Friendly Interface Allows 1.1 kW Generator Capacity to 1.0 KVA UPS Load
• Advanced Battery-Control Ingenuity Produces Low DC Ripple -- Extending Battery and Capacitor Life
• Fail-Safe Design Incorporates Robust, Conservatively Engineered Devices to Reduce Failures and Ensure
Reliability
Power when Subjected to Severe Step Loads with Minimal Utilization of Batteries
High Efciency Design
• G8000MM Efficiency Greater than 90% at Loads 25% and Larger
• Higher Efficiency Means Lower Power Losses Equating to Lower
Utility Cost
• Lower Air-Conditioning Requirements
• Reduced Total Cost of Operation and Ownership
• High Efficiency Provides Rapid Return of Investment
Hybrid Static Transfer Switch
• Each UPS Module Equipped with Hybrid Static-Transfer Bypass
Switch
• In-Line Configuration and Make-Before-Break Switch Design
Ensure a Seamless Transfer of Power to Critical Load
• Redundant Switches Reduce Single Point of Failure in One Static
Switch Cabinet Design
• Hybrid SCR/Contactor Design Improves Static-Switch Efficiency
to Nearly 100%
• Lowers Utility Cost and Overall Cost of Operation

G8000MM UPS Options
Remote Monitoring
RemotEye II® offers remote real-time monitoring and analysis of UPS operation via HTTP and SNMP.
• Multiple Monitoring Options: Locally at UPS, at Tie-Cabinet,
Remotely via Local Area Network, or Annunciator
• Each UPS Module’s Data Port may be Tied to Optional
Network Monitor
• Optional Industrial Bus ProtoNode Module Supports:
SNMPTCP/IP
An optional hard-wired remote alarm sensing panel (RASP) enables remote monitoring of UPS alarm/status points up to 1000 feet away.
ModbusRTU
AB Ethernet IPBACnet
Metasys N2MSTP
Tie-Cabinet System Monitor
In multi-module systems, the G8000MM UPS tie-cabinet has a five-inch color LCD display for monitoring unit and system status.
